JMAM's creator, Jirah May A. Millano, is a budding watercolor artist and visual storyteller who hopes to portray Filipino tales via portraiture and architectural paintings. She also works as a freelance graphic designer, providing social media visuals and print layouts for female fashion companies. Jirah has also just created "Charm Manila," an accessory line that focuses on a certain topic at a time and delivers carefully picked collections. She is a member of the United Fine Artists of the Philippines, the Philippine Guild of Watercolorists, the Philippine Botanical Art Society, the Philippine Fauna Art Society, and the Philippine Guild of Watercolorists. Her work is heavily impacted by locations and buildings that help define the human experience as a BS Architecture graduate from Pamantasan ng Lungsod ng Maynila. https://lemiapp.com/jirahmillano
